class |
CostlyGraph
A default setting for a DirectedGraph of Coord vertices where each passable cell has a cost to enter it from any
passable neighbor.
|
class |
DefaultGraph
A default setting for an
UndirectedGraph of Coord vertices where all connections have cost 1. |
class |
DirectedGraph<V>
A kind of
Graph where all connections between vertices are one-way (but a connection may exist that goes from
A to B and another connection may go from B to A), and each connection can have a different cost. |
class |
UndirectedGraph<V>
A kind of
Graph where all connections between vertices are two-way and have equal cost for traveling A to B
or B to A. |
